The Royal Bengal Tiger Cafe in Tollygunge, Kolkata is a modern-day cafe dedicated towards creating awareness about tiger conservation. Having both indoor and outdoor casual seating arrangements, this cafe is pleasantly decorated and exudes European grandeur. Two colours are extensively used here—yellow and black—which go well with its tiger-theme. In addition, there are several paintings of tigers adorning the walls. The breakfast menu offered here is extensive and includes an array of Bengali, Chinese and European delicacies. Try Bengali-styled fish and mutton chops. Do not miss out on tasting fish fry, dimsums and shorshe chicken (mustard chicken) sandwich, which are finger-licking.
